More Webinars On Tap For Small Businesses

The Alabama Small Business Development Center (SBDC) at the University of South Alabama recently announced more webinars in addition to its Small Business Survival Series (Small Business Webinars Announced). Local Initiatives Support Corp. is kicking off its quarterly “Doing Business Online” series on January 13 with “5 Simple Strategies for Creating a Winning Website.” On January 14, the “CARES Act Small Business Recovery Course” is continuing with its sixth module, “Fiscal Year-End Closing Compliance.” The eight-module course can be taken in any order, as a series or individually. Registration is required to receive the Zoom links. A full calendar of SBDC’s webinars is also available.
